L&T draws up a $2.5-billion green energy plan; co looks to also manufacture key tech instruments

Mumbai: Engineering major Larsen and Toubro (L&T) plans to invest up to $2.5 billion (₹20,000 crore) in building its green energy portfolio, a senior company official said.

“We are looking at up to $2.5 billion of investment over the next four years in our green portfolio, depending on how the market evolves,” said Subramanian Sarma, senior executive vice-president (energy), L&T.
